抽穗期叶面喷施鸟氨酸对香稻产量、品质以及2-乙酰基-1-吡咯啉生物合成的影响  

Effects of Foliar Ornithine Spraying at Heading Stage on Yield,Quality and 2-Acetyl-1-Pyrroline Biosynthesis of Fragrant Rice

摘  要:为探究抽穗期叶面喷施鸟氨酸对香稻产量、品质以及2-乙酰基-1-吡咯啉(2-AP)生物合成的影响,以广东省主推香稻品种美香占2号为材料,进行了2年的大田试验,于抽穗期对香稻植株喷施不同浓度的鸟氨酸溶液,对香稻产量及其构成因素、稻米品质和2-AP合成特性进行比较分析。结果表明,喷施浓度为0.4~1.6g/L的鸟氨酸溶液可显著增加灌浆期剑叶叶绿素含量,提高香稻的产量以及稻米的粗蛋白含量,降低垩白度和垩白粒率。与对照相比,鸟氨酸处理下香稻2-AP含量显著提高了14.81%~30.62%。可见,外源喷施鸟氨酸在香稻生产中具有一定的应用价值。In order to explore the effect of foliar ornithine spraying at the heading stage on the yield,quality and 2-acetyl-1-pyrroline(2-AP)biosynthesis of fragrant rice,the main fragrant rice variety Meixiangzhan 2 in Guangdong province was used as the material,and a two-year field experiment was carried out.During the heading stage,the fragrant rice plants were sprayed with different concentrations of ornithine solution.Rice quality and 2-AP synthesis characteristics were compared and analyzed.The results showed that spraying ornithine solution with a concentration of 0.4-1.6g/L could significantly increase the chlorophyll content of flag leaves during the filling stage,increase the yield of fragrant rice and the crude protein content of rice,and reduce the chalkiness and chalky grain rate.Compared with the control,the 2-AP contents of fragrant rice under the treatments of spraying ornithine were significantly increased by 14.81%-30.62%.It could be seen that exogenous ornithine has certain application value in fragrant rice production.
